說說我淺薄的認(rèn)識,請大神們指正。
你跑著的Nginx容器并不是使用的你宿主機(jī)(mac)的內(nèi)核,因為docker所依賴的namespaces、cgroups的功能在你的宿主機(jī)上并沒有。你能在mac上跑docker容器,是因為一個名叫Docker.app的程序提供了一層抽象,它介于宿主機(jī)和docker之間,提供了容器所倚賴的Linux的namespaces、cgroups等功能。
在Linux上跑著的各個docker容器是真的共享了Linux內(nèi)核,但mac上跑著的各個docker容器并不是共享了mac的內(nèi)核。換個角度,從github上把docker的源代碼克隆下來并編譯,編譯得到的二進(jìn)制程序并不能直接跑在mac上。
ubuntu這類docker鏡像中并不包含Linux內(nèi)核,反過來想,要是包含了Linux內(nèi)核這個鏡像大小肯定不止這點。
git log cd4ae953901d6723a2827040b47491b9c0965863 -1 --name-only
public ServletOutputStream getOutputStream()
throws IOException {
if (usingWriter) {
throw new IllegalStateException
(sm.getString("coyoteResponse.getOutputStream.ise"));
}
usingOutputStream = true;
if (outputStream == null) {
outputStream = new CoyoteOutputStream(outputBuffer);
}
return outputStream;
}
調(diào)用getOutputStream方法后會執(zhí)行usingOutputStream = true;
再調(diào)用getWriter方法
if (usingOutputStream) {
throw new IllegalStateException
(sm.getString("coyoteResponse.getWriter.ise"));
}
就會拋出這個異常,if <code>getOutputStream</code> has
* already been called for this response,所以不能同時使用。中間件wechat.js中的wechat函數(shù)中return關(guān)鍵字刪除
不可能,資源是有限的,如果有方式讓一份資源有大于一份的產(chǎn)出,顯然這是違背物理邏輯的。
除非說容器內(nèi)跑得東西并無任何優(yōu)化(資源占用,線程調(diào)度等等),那么拆分兩個容器會有一種好像計算能力超出宿主機(jī)的能力的錯覺。
docker 是為了屏蔽差異,但是這種抽象層本身就會消耗資源的一部分。
如果真的要極致性能,還不如從頭寫一個內(nèi)核讓它只負(fù)責(zé)一個任務(wù)來獨占一切計算資源。
兩個容器只能盡可能的壓榨宿主的性能,多數(shù)情況下(編碼水平)可能還做不到。
<url-pattern>/</url-pattern>:
會匹配到/springmvc這樣的路徑型url,不會匹配到模式為*.jsp這樣的后綴型url。
<url-pattern>/*</url-pattern>:
會匹配所有的url:路徑型的和后綴型的url(包括/springmvc,.jsp,.js和*.html等)。
It will accept http://host:port/context/hello, but reject http://host:port/context/hello.jsp
下面是關(guān)于這個問題在stack overflow上的解釋:
原文鏈接:http://stackoverflow.com/ques...
閉包:
for (var i = 0; i < 10; i++) {
(function(j) {
setTimeout(function() {
console.log(j);
}, j * 1000)
})(i);
}filter可以用的,創(chuàng)一個filter.js文件
/**
* Vue過濾器
*/
import Vue from 'vue'
export default (function() {
//多個按鈕或標(biāo)簽顯示不同顏色
Vue.filter('getBtnColorful', function(val) {
var corlorClasses = ['green', 'yellow'];
return corlorClasses[val];
})
})()
在main.js中引入import filter from './filter';
示例化Vue的時候,把filter丟進(jìn)去就行了
const app = new Vue({
el: '#app',
router,
store,
filters: filter,
render: h => h(App)
});分布式系統(tǒng)需要部署到多節(jié)點,除了性能需求外,還是考慮容災(zāi)需求。最簡單的有 mysql 主備兩節(jié)點部署,復(fù)雜的有兩地三中心部署。
寫到updated鉤子函數(shù)里面試試
在console.log('連接成功‘)上面寫console.log('err',error); console.log('db',db); 你看一下輸出的是什么。。。這個要自己debug.
就是執(zhí)行v.default 方法,傳進(jìn)去一個參數(shù) "_w_tb_nick"
最后安裝上,MD不加sudo 直接npm install polymer-cli -g 就好了。。。。。。。。。。。
F12看了百度地圖全景,canvas繪圖實現(xiàn)的,拍攝大量圖片,剩下的就是js + css3了
我有個比較拙劣的想法 代碼如下:
<div id="app">
<p v-html="amessage"></p>
<input type="checkbox" value="pingguo" v-model="message">
<input type="checkbox" value="xiangjiao" v-model="message">
<input type="checkbox" value="chengzi" v-model="message">
</div>
<script>
new Vue({
el: "#app",
data() {
return {
message: []
}
},
computed: {
amessage: function () {
let obj = ''
this.message.forEach(function (item) {
console.log(item)
obj = obj + " " + item
})
return obj
}
}
})
</script>
使用computed可以實現(xiàn) 這是效果圖
之前看到過用純css畫了一個很復(fù)雜的動畫人物,可以看出css還是挺強(qiáng)大的,不過目前來說,用css畫圖確實不怎么樣,可以考慮用canvas,或者直接叫美工畫一個。如果非要用css,可以去網(wǎng)上找找,應(yīng)該有類似文章,不過歸根結(jié)底都不是非常規(guī)范的做法,而且兼容性也可能有問題。
你改的是div里面的assetsPublicPath,你應(yīng)該該bulid里面的,改對了文件,改錯了行。
iOS 好像可以直接用 AppStore 的分享鏈接跳轉(zhuǎn)的。
xib創(chuàng)建的Controller的View初始值就是(600,600), 你可以在viewWillAppear方法中添加創(chuàng)建的HUD, 或者是在viewDidLoad中設(shè)置View的Frame: self.view.frame = [UIScreen mainScreen].bounds.size然后添加HUD.
北大青鳥APTECH成立于1999年。依托北京大學(xué)優(yōu)質(zhì)雄厚的教育資源和背景,秉承“教育改變生活”的發(fā)展理念,致力于培養(yǎng)中國IT技能型緊缺人才,是大數(shù)據(jù)專業(yè)的國家
達(dá)內(nèi)教育集團(tuán)成立于2002年,是一家由留學(xué)海歸創(chuàng)辦的高端職業(yè)教育培訓(xùn)機(jī)構(gòu),是中國一站式人才培養(yǎng)平臺、一站式人才輸送平臺。2014年4月3日在美國成功上市,融資1
北大課工場是北京大學(xué)校辦產(chǎn)業(yè)為響應(yīng)國家深化產(chǎn)教融合/校企合作的政策,積極推進(jìn)“中國制造2025”,實現(xiàn)中華民族偉大復(fù)興的升級產(chǎn)業(yè)鏈。利用北京大學(xué)優(yōu)質(zhì)教育資源及背
博為峰,中國職業(yè)人才培訓(xùn)領(lǐng)域的先行者
曾工作于聯(lián)想擔(dān)任系統(tǒng)開發(fā)工程師,曾在博彥科技股份有限公司擔(dān)任項目經(jīng)理從事移動互聯(lián)網(wǎng)管理及研發(fā)工作,曾創(chuàng)辦藍(lán)懿科技有限責(zé)任公司從事總經(jīng)理職務(wù)負(fù)責(zé)iOS教學(xué)及管理工作。
浪潮集團(tuán)項目經(jīng)理。精通Java與.NET 技術(shù), 熟練的跨平臺面向?qū)ο箝_發(fā)經(jīng)驗,技術(shù)功底深厚。 授課風(fēng)格 授課風(fēng)格清新自然、條理清晰、主次分明、重點難點突出、引人入勝。
精通HTML5和CSS3;Javascript及主流js庫,具有快速界面開發(fā)的能力,對瀏覽器兼容性、前端性能優(yōu)化等有深入理解。精通網(wǎng)頁制作和網(wǎng)頁游戲開發(fā)。
具有10 年的Java 企業(yè)應(yīng)用開發(fā)經(jīng)驗。曾經(jīng)歷任德國Software AG 技術(shù)顧問,美國Dachieve 系統(tǒng)架構(gòu)師,美國AngelEngineers Inc. 系統(tǒng)架構(gòu)師。